Fixed vs. Adjustable Dumbbells

In my experience, fixed dumbbells are the easiest to use because I can grab them and start training right away. They are often more stable and better for fast-paced workouts. Adjustable dumbbells, on the other hand, are great if I want multiple weight options in one compact set. If my workout space is small, I usually lean toward adjustable models.

Grip and Handle Comfort

One of the first things I notice is the handle grip. If the handle feels too thick, too smooth, or too rough, my workout becomes less comfortable. I look for a knurled or textured grip because it helps me hold the dumbbells securely, especially during sweaty sessions. A comfortable handle makes a big difference in how long I can train without hand fatigue.

Material and Durability

I pay close attention to the material because it affects how long the dumbbells last. Rubber-coated dumbbells are often quieter and help protect my floors. Cast iron options feel solid and reliable, but they may be noisier and less forgiving on surfaces. If I want long-term use, I make sure the construction feels sturdy and well-balanced.

Space and Storage Considerations

I always think about where I will store the dumbbells. A 45 lb set can take up more room than I expect, especially if it includes multiple pieces. If I have limited space, I prefer a compact rack or adjustable design. Good storage helps keep my workout area organized and makes it easier for me to stay consistent.

Best Use Cases for Me

I find a 45 lb dumbbell set useful for home strength training, muscle building, and full-body workouts. It works well for exercises like lunges, goblet squats, bent-over rows, deadlifts, and presses. If I am building a home gym, this weight range gives me enough resistance to challenge myself without needing a large collection of equipment.
